1988 or thereabout I bought Appetite for Destruction. It was the most extreme thing I had heard then and I knew I wanted to hear something as, or more, extreme. I got into Metallica and Over Kill after that and then Iron Maiden and then Death Metal in '90 or '91 and Black Metal in '93 when I first saw Varg Vikernes on the cover of Kerrang! magazine. |

I started with punkrock at about 13, but pretty soon turned towards the more extreme UK-shit like Discharge, Amebix, ENT and that likes. Then somehow discovered Metallica covering Discharge and immediately got hooked by "Kill 'em All", the first 100% Metal record I ever listened to. That new musical taste again developed towards the extremes, Death Metal totally took over! Now, more than 7 years after discovering the raging power of punk, I'm somewhere in between Death and Black Metal, discovering new stuffs from time to time and (simply because of having a job) getting together lots of all-time-favourites. I also managed to start a band and a Death Metal dedicated 'zine, so things are going quite fine at the moment... |
